- 博客(4)
- 收藏
- 关注
原创 android ndk程序UnsatisfiedLinkError解决方法
今天在写一个android上通过ndk调用c代码来实现对图片灰度的出来,把处理后的数组返回到java层,当我编写好c的代码的后,build好so文件,在调用对应的处理方法的时候报了UnsatisfiedLinkError:toGray的错误,找了很久原因,很多文章都说是名称错误或者是加载so文件异常,我确定我的so加载没问题,但是方法名称又是 一样的,就是死活都报那个异常,后来方法在实现头文件
2013-04-19 18:03:06 1064
原创 解决nkd-build提示使用c99编译和c99前不支持的语法
在使用for循环的时候经常是这样的for(int i = 0;i ok大功告成啦。。。编译通过。。。。。
2013-04-19 17:52:55 3924 1
原创 java 常用jni方法和知识点
下面是访问String的一些方法: GetStringUTFChars将jstring转换成为UTF-8格式的char* GetStringChars将jstring转换成为Unicode格式的char* ReleaseStringUTFChars释放指向UTF-8格式的char*的指针 ReleaseStringChars释放指向Unicode格式的char*的指针
2013-04-19 17:25:36 940
原创 使用eclipse开发,生成jni头文件命名
进入到bin目录下的classes目录下:执行javah -classpath . -jni com.myjni.jni.BitmapUtils .代表当前目录 -classpath为类载入目录,-jni为命令操作项 后面的就是生成的h的文件名称eddy@eddy-MS-7636:~/ZAKRESHOP/A_shake/bin/classes$ javah -classpa
2013-04-18 17:39:49 955
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人